allosteric-pathways's Introduction

This repository contains a jupyter notebook tutorial together with the necessary information and code for extracting allosteric pathways in proteins, including multimeric proteins and protein complexes.

The calculations can also be done via command line as demonstrated in example_protein_cofactor_network_analysis.sh.

Citing this work
The code and developments are described in two papers.

[1] P.W. Kang, A.M. Westerlund, J. Shi, K. MacFarland White, A.K. Dou, A.H. Cui, J.R. Silva, L. Delemotte and J. Cui. Calmodulin acts as a state-dependent switch to control a cardiac potassium channel opening. 2020

[2] A.M. Westerlund, O. Fleetwood, S. Perez-Conesa and L. Delemotte. Network analysis reveals how lipids and other cofactors influence membrane protein allostery. 2020


Annie Westerlund, KTH Royal Institute of Technology, 2020
